David Schwimmer is a renowned actor and director best known for his role as Ross Geller in the iconic television series "Friends." With a career spanning over two decades, Schwimmer has showcased his versatility in various roles across television and film. His contributions to the entertainment industry, along with his advocacy for social issues, have made him a respected figure both on and off the screen. Born on November 2, 1966, in New York City, David Schwimmer grew up in a family that valued the arts. His early exposure to theater and performance ignited a passion for acting that would shape his future. After studying acting at Northwestern University, Schwimmer embarked on his professional journey, quickly gaining recognition for his talent and charisma. Career Highlights

David Schwimmer's career took off when he landed the role of Ross Geller on the hit sitcom "Friends." The show, which premiered in 1994, became a cultural phenomenon and solidified Schwimmer's status as a household name. His portrayal of Ross, a paleontologist navigating the complexities of love and friendship, earned him critical acclaim and a loyal fanbase.
